Nynke Weisglas‐Kuperus is a scholar working on Pediatrics, Perinatology and Child Health, Health, Toxicology and Mutagenesis and Pulmonary and Respiratory Medicine. According to data from OpenAlex, Nynke Weisglas‐Kuperus has authored 71 papers receiving a total of 6.3k ind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 37 papers in Pediatrics, Perinatology and Child Health, 29 papers in Health, Toxicology and Mutagenesis and 19 papers in Pulmonary and Respiratory Medicine. Recurrent topics in Nynke Weisglas‐Kuperus’s work include Infant Development and Preterm Care (27 papers), Toxic Organic Pollutants Impact (26 papers) and Air Quality and Health Impacts (20 papers). Nynke Weisglas‐Kuperus is often cited by papers focused on Infant Development and Preterm Care (27 papers), Toxic Organic Pollutants Impact (26 papers) and Air Quality and Health Impacts (20 papers). Nynke Weisglas‐Kuperus collaborates with scholars based in The Netherlands, United States and Belgium. Nynke Weisglas‐Kuperus's co-authors include Johannes B. van Goudoever, Cornelieke S.H. Aarnoudse-Moens, Jaap Oosterlaan, Pieter J.J. Sauer, Corine Koopman-Esseboom, Paul Mulder, Svati Patandin, L.G.M.Th. Tuinstra, E. Rudy Boersma and Pieter J. J. Sauer and has published in prestigious journals such as PLoS ONE, Neurology and PEDIATRICS.
